Skip to content

Commit 73f0158

Browse files
committed
fix
1 parent 854bf77 commit 73f0158

File tree

3 files changed

+8
-34
lines changed

3 files changed

+8
-34
lines changed

include/cppredis/cpp_redis_list.hpp

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 namespace cpp_redis {
1919
{
2020
check_args();
2121

22-
std::string msg = request_->req_n_key_value(request_->get_cmd(cpp_redis::rpush),
22+
std::string msg = request_->req_n_key(request_->get_cmd(cpp_redis::rpush),
2323
std::forward<std::string>(key), std::forward<std::string>(value));
2424
socket_->send_msg(std::move(msg));
2525

@@ -38,7 +38,7 @@ namespace cpp_redis {
3838
{
3939
check_args();
4040

41-
std::string msg = request_->req_n_key_value(request_->get_cmd(cpp_redis::rpushx),
41+
std::string msg = request_->req_n_key(request_->get_cmd(cpp_redis::rpushx),
4242
std::forward<std::string>(key), std::forward<std::string>(value));
4343
socket_->send_msg(std::move(msg));
4444

@@ -57,7 +57,7 @@ namespace cpp_redis {
5757
{
5858
check_args();
5959

60-
std::string msg = request_->req_n_key_value(request_->get_cmd(cpp_redis::lpush),
60+
std::string msg = request_->req_n_key(request_->get_cmd(cpp_redis::lpush),
6161
std::forward<std::string>(key), std::forward<std::string>(value));
6262
socket_->send_msg(std::move(msg));
6363

@@ -76,7 +76,7 @@ namespace cpp_redis {
7676
{
7777
check_args();
7878

79-
std::string msg = request_->req_n_key_value(request_->get_cmd(cpp_redis::lpushx),
79+
std::string msg = request_->req_n_key(request_->get_cmd(cpp_redis::lpushx),
8080
std::forward<std::string>(key), std::forward<std::string>(value));
8181
socket_->send_msg(std::move(msg));
8282

include/cppredis/cpp_redis_request.hpp

Lines changed: 0 additions & 28 deletions
Original file line numberDiff line numberDiff line change
@@ -319,34 +319,6 @@ namespace cpp_redis {
319319
return build_respone(std::move(command), std::move(cmds));
320320
}
321321

322-
template<typename...Args>
323-
std::string req_n_key_value(std::string&& command, Args&&...key_value)
324-
{
325-
auto tuple = std::make_tuple<Args...>(std::forward<Args>(key_value)...);
326-
PAIRS pairs;
327-
328-
int count = 0;
329-
PAIR pair;
330-
cpp_redis::unit::for_each_tuple_front(tuple, [this, &pairs, &count, &pair](std::string str, const int& index) {
331-
if (count < 2) {
332-
if (count == 0) {
333-
pair.first = std::move(str);
334-
}
335-
else
336-
{
337-
pair.second = std::move(str);
338-
pairs.push_back(std::move(pair));
339-
count = 0;
340-
return;
341-
}
342-
}
343-
344-
++count;
345-
});
346-
347-
return build_respone(std::move(command), std::move(pairs));
348-
}
349-
350322
std::string req_n_keys(std::string&& command, KEYS&& keys)
351323
{
352324
return build_respone(std::move(command), std::forward<KEYS>(keys));

include/cppredis/cpp_redis_string.hpp

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-46,7 +46,8 @@ namespace cpp_redis {
4646

4747
virtual bool set(std::string&& key, std::string&& value)
4848
{
49-
std::string msg = request_->req_n_key_value(request_->get_cmd(redis_cmd::set), std::forward<std::string>(key), std::forward<std::string>(value));
49+
std::string msg = request_->req_n_key(request_->get_cmd(redis_cmd::set),
50+
std::forward<std::string>(key), std::forward<std::string>(value));
5051
socket_->send_msg(std::move(msg));
5152

5253
const auto res = socket_->get_responese();
@@ -260,7 +261,8 @@ namespace cpp_redis {
260261
{
261262
check_args();
262263

263-
std::string msg = request_->req_n_key_value(request_->get_cmd(redis_cmd::get_set), std::forward<std::string>(key), std::forward <std::string>(value));
264+
std::string msg = request_->req_n_key(request_->get_cmd(redis_cmd::get_set),
265+
std::forward<std::string>(key), std::forward <std::string>(value));
264266
socket_->send_msg(std::move(msg));
265267

266268
const auto res = socket_->get_responese();

0 commit comments

Comments
 (0)